#body { 
	margin: 0px;
	text-align: center;
	border:0;
	}
	
html, body {padding: 0; width: 100%; height: 100%; }

#bg_image { position: fixed; top: 0; left: 0; z-index: 1; width: 100%; height: 100%; }	
	
#scrollable { position: absolute; width: 100%; height: 100%; top: 0; left: 0; z-index: 2; }

.top{
margin:0px auto; 
text-align: left;
width: 1020px;
padding: 0px;
 border:0;
}

.left{
float: left; 
width:100px;height:780px;}

.right{
float: right;
width:100px;}

.main{
width: 820px;
float: left;}

/*.content {width:1020px;margin:0px auto; 
text-align: left;}*/
.content {width: 1020px; height: 100%;
margin: 0px auto;
	text-align: center;}

.leftbg {float: left; width:200px; height:40px;}

.rightbg {float: right; width: 200px; height:40px;}

.nav {float: left; width: 620px; height: 40px; background-image:url("../images/navbg.jpg");}

.home { 
width: 80px;
height: 40px; 
background-image:url("../images/01_home_nav_01.gif"); 
float: left;
} 

a.home:hover{ 
background-position: -80px 0; 
} 

.about { 
width: 110px;
height: 40px; 
background-image:url("../images/02_about_nav.gif"); 
float: left;
} 
a.about:hover{ 
background-position: -110px 0; 
} 


.loc { 
width: 100px;
height: 40px; 
background-image:url("../images/03_locations_nav.gif"); 
float: left;	
} 
a.loc:hover{ 
background-position: -100px 0; 
} 

.prc { 
width: 98px;
height: 40px; 
background-image:url("../images/04_piercings_nav.gif"); 
float: left;	
} 
a.prc:hover{ 
background-position: -98px 0; 
}

.str { 
width: 120px;
height: 40px; 
background-image:url("../images/05_sterilization_nav.gif"); 
float: left;	
} 
a.str:hover{ 
background-position: -120px 0; 
}

.tat { 
width: 102px;
height: 40px; 
background-image:url("../images/06_tattoos_nav.gif"); 
float: left;	
} 
a.tat:hover{ 
background-position: -102px 0; 
}

.link1 {float: left; height:40px;!important width:80px;}
.link2 {float: left; height:40px;!important width:110px;}
.link3 {float: left; height:40px;!important width:100px;}
.link4 {float: left; height:40px;!important width:98px;}
.link5 {float: left; height:40px;!important width:120px;}
.link6 {float: left; height:40px;!important width:102px;}

.shadow { float: left; height: 1020px; width: 10px; background-image:url("../images/shadow.gif"); padding: 0px; margin: 0px 0px 0px 0px; border:none;}
.container {margin:0px auto; border:0;
text-align: left;
width: 1040px;}

.muchologo {width:150px; height:13px; display:block;
    position:absolute;
    top:2px;
    right:0px;
	color: #000000;
    border:1px solid #FFF;
	z-index:99;
	font-family: "Courier New", Courier, monospace;
	font-size: 10px;
	text-align:center; vertical-align:middle;}

.mucholink {font-family: "Courier New", Courier, monospace;
	font-size: 11px;}
a.mucholink:link {text-decoration:none; color: #FFF;}
a.mucholink:hover {text-decoration:underline; color: #FFF;}
a.mucholink:visited {text-decoration:none; color: #FFF;}

.footer {float:left; margin-top:-307px; margin-left:20px; width:780px;}